Application Development

Full-cycle development of mobile and desktop applications tailored to your business needs. We deliver high-quality software solutions on time.

Application Development

Overview

Custom application development is about solving unique business challenges with tailored software solutions. Whether you need a mobile app, desktop application, or web platform, we build solutions that fit your exact requirements.

We follow a full-cycle development approach from requirements gathering and architecture design to development, testing, deployment, and ongoing support. Our agile methodology ensures you're involved throughout the process with regular demos and feedback loops.

Every application we build is designed with scalability, security, and user experience in mind. We use modern architectures and best practices to ensure your application can grow with your business.

Key Benefits

Custom applications for business needs

Optimized architecture for performance

Seamless cross-platform experience

Modernization Journey

Step 01

Discovery & Roadmap

Deep-diving into your business logic and user needs to create a comprehensive technical requirement document and project roadmap.

Step 02

Cloud-Native Architecture

Designing scalable, secure, and elastic system architectures using microservices or serverless patterns tailored for growth.

Step 03

Iterative Development

Rapidly building features through Agile sprints, featuring bi-weekly demos and constant feedback integration.

Step 04

Quality Assurance

Rigorous automated and manual testing cycles to ensure zero-defect releases and optimal performance across all platforms.

Step 05

DevOps & Launch

Automated deployment pipelines (CI/CD) and infrastructure provisioning for a smooth, reliable production launch.

Use Cases

Productivity apps

Healthcare solutions

Enterprise desktop apps

Technical Pillars

Strategic solutions engineered to resolve legacy complexity and unlock modern performance.

Enterprise Software

Large-scale, high-concurrency systems designed to automate complex business processes and manage massive data sets.

SaaS Platforms

Multi-tenant cloud applications with robust subscription management, analytics, and global scalability.

Cross-Platform Mobile

High-performance iOS and Android applications built with a single codebase using Flutter or React Native.

API Ecosystems

Architecting secure, well-documented RESTful and GraphQL APIs to power your entire application landscape.

Technologies We Use

Flutter
React
Next.js
Node.js
Electron
PostgreSQL
MongoDB
Firebase
AWS
Docker

Frequently Asked Questions

What's the difference between custom and off-the-shelf software?

Custom software is built specifically for your business needs, workflows, and requirements. Off-the-shelf software is generic and may require you to adapt your processes. Custom development offers better fit, competitive advantage, and long-term cost savings despite higher initial investment.

How do you gather requirements?

We conduct stakeholder interviews, workshops, and process analysis to understand your needs. We create user stories, wireframes, and prototypes to validate requirements before development begins. This ensures we build exactly what you need.

What's your development process?

We use Agile methodology with 2-week sprints. Each sprint includes planning, development, testing, and a demo. You'll have regular visibility into progress and can provide feedback throughout. We also maintain comprehensive documentation.

Do you provide training and support?

Yes, we provide user training, administrator training, comprehensive documentation, and ongoing support packages. We ensure your team is comfortable using the application and can get help when needed.

Ready to Energize Your Project?

Join thousands of others experiencing the power of lightning-fast technology